## Problem Wrong credentials produced garbled error messages (`"login failed: Login failed: bad_credentials"`) and stale credentials remained cached after failure, causing silent re-use on the next invocation. ## Solution Standardize all scrapers to emit `"bad_credentials"` as a plain error code, mapped to a human-readable string via `LOGIN_ERRORS` in `constants.lua`. Fix `credentials.lua` to clear cached credentials on failure in both the fresh-prompt and re-prompt paths. For AtCoder and Codeforces, replace `wait_for_url` with `wait_for_function` to detect the login error element immediately rather than sitting the full 10s navigation timeout. Add "Remember me" checkbox on Codeforces login.
